Booked one hour of water skiing for 2 children. At the reception we were sent to a building and there would be someone there to help us. There was only a young lady who operated the cables and no one else to show us around. Finally, someone from cleaning showed us the room where we could get our things. Skies, life jacket and helmet. No explanation whatsoever as to which sizes were suitable or anything like that.
When it was our turn at 2:00 PM, a brief explanation was given about what to do. At the same time, there was a group of subscribers, or at least friends of the lady who managed the cable and gave the explanation, who were fooling around and basically dominated everything.
There were no other staff present to intervene if something went wrong. If you fall on the other side of the lake and get injured (or worse) there is no lifeguard or staff member to help you. You must always swim or walk back under your own power. If you fall in the wrong place it can take 15 to 20 minutes before you can ski again.
After an hour of skiing, we complained to reception, but we felt that we were not taken seriously. Nothing was noted, but they would talk to the lady who managed the cable.
All in all not value for our money. For €20.00 per hour per child, I expect a little more personal attention and more attention to safety.
